The Protein Detection Quantification Market is set for strong growth, driven by the increasing need for effective biomarker identification, improvements in drug discovery, and the growing use of proteomics in clinical diagnostics. The market was valued at USD 2.7 billion in 2023 and is expected to reach USD 6.9 billion by 2031, growing at a CAGR of 12.4% from 2024 to 2031. Protein detection and quantification technologies are essential for understanding disease mechanisms and developing therapies. These technologies are moving from specialized lab tools to common applications in pharmaceuticals, diagnostics, and biotechnology. Increased investments in proteomics research, along with advances in immunoassays, mass spectrometry, and fluorescence-based detection systems, are driving market adoption.
Market Segmentation
By Technology
- Mass Spectrometry: The gold standard for accurate protein detection and quantification.
- Western Blotting: Widely used in research and diagnostics for analyzing protein expression.
- ELISA & Immunoassays: High-throughput and cost-efficient solutions for clinical and research applications.
- Others: Includes chromatography and new nanotechnology-based platforms.
By Application
- Drug Discovery & Development: The largest segment, mainly driven by pharmaceutical R&D.
- Clinical Diagnostics: Increasing use in identifying disease biomarkers.
- Food & Agriculture Testing: Monitoring protein levels for quality and safety.
- Others: Academic research and biotechnology innovations.
By End-User
- Pharmaceutical & Biotechnology Companies: The main users for developing therapies.
- Academic & Research Institutes: Growing use for discoveries in proteomics.
- Diagnostic Laboratories: Increasing reliance on precise diagnostics.

Recent Developments (Last 6 to 8 Months)
- July 2025: Thermo Fisher Scientific launched next-gen protein quantification kits with better sensitivity for drug development.
- April 2025: Agilent Technologies introduced AI-driven mass spectrometry software for quicker data interpretation.
- February 2025: Bio-Rad announced collaborations with academic centers to widen proteomics research applications.
- December 2024: Merck KGaA expanded its protein detection product line with nanotechnology-based assays.
Revenue Insights
Drug discovery applications currently dominate revenue, with pharmaceutical and biotech companies being the largest customers. Clinical diagnostics is anticipated to be the fastest-growing segment, fueled by demands for personalized medicine and early disease detection. Mass spectrometry commands the highest revenue share among technologies thanks to its precision and reliability.
Regional Insights
North America leads the Protein Detection Quantification Market, backed by a strong pharmaceutical pipeline, extensive proteomics research, and significant government and private funding for advanced protein analysis. Europe closely follows, stimulated by academic research, clinical diagnostics, and collaborative biotechnology initiatives, with government grants and stringent regulations promoting the use of high-quality detection technologies. Together, these regions are driving advancements in protein quantification, biomarker discovery, and precision medicine, reinforcing their strength in the global market.
